Visions of Dissent: Anna Trapnell's Role in the Cromwellian Era
This chapter delves into the remarkable life of Anna Trapnell, whose prophetic visions during the English Civil War positioned her as a significant voice against Oliver Cromwell's rule. It examines her background, the political consequences of her revelations, and the journey that led to her imprisonment and awakening as a politically engaged individual.
